VeriSTAR Hull 5.26.1: Advanced Ship Hull Structural Verification Software
VeriSTAR Hull is Bureau Veritas’s advanced ship hull verification tool, built on the flexible Femap software from Siemens . It is designed to help shipyards verify structural compliance during the design phase, merging design and verification processes to make compliance a seamless part of the design pipeline .
The software is widely adopted in shipyards across Korea, China, and Japan, offering speed, accuracy, and adaptability in structural verification . It is continuously updated with the latest editions of Common Structural Rules (CSR-H) and internal standards for various vessel types .

⚡ Key Features & Capabilities
-
Finite Element Analysis (FEA): Performs stress, buckling, and fatigue analysis according to classification society rules .
-
CSR-H Compliance: Continuously updated to comply with the latest harmonised Common Structural Rules for oil tankers and bulk carriers .
-
Hydro-structure Coupling: Capable of carrying out complex coupling analysis based on site-specific met-ocean data and loading conditions .
-
Design Integration: Merges the design and verification processes, eliminating the separation between the two disciplines .
-
Integrated Meshing: Utilizes tools like HydroSTAR for automatic mesh generation to speed up the modeling process .
